Function of Substations in Energy Distribution and Transmission Programs
A substation is basically a hub for high-voltage transmission strains, serving as a important junction level the place the excessive voltage is stepped right down to a decrease voltage appropriate for distribution. That is achieved by means of using transformers, which change the voltage ranges between the transmitted and distributed energies.
Switching and Transformers inside Substations
Switching and transformers are main parts of a substation’s infrastructure. Switching refers back to the strategy of connecting or disconnecting electrical circuits to handle power circulate inside the substation. That is usually achieved utilizing switches, circuit breakers, or different sorts of management gadgets.
Switching is crucial to make sure reliability, security, and effectivity inside a substation.

Transformers and Substation Effectivity
A important side of any substation is the transformers used to step up or step down voltage ranges. These transformers are designed to reduce power losses, which might happen resulting from components similar to resistance, leakage, and eddy currents.
A well-designed transformer is crucial to making sure the effectivity and reliability of a substation, because it straight impacts power supply and the related prices.
